Implement the structured service if you require DS0 midspan drop-and-insert. (See
Figure 186.)

Midspan drop and insert allows services such as public switched telephone service
to be inserted into the ATM link. Combining this service with Ethernet bridge
service will provide you with a complete integrated communications access
solution, as shown in Figure 187.
